3 Human-centered design approach
DISCOVER DEFINE DEVELOP DELIVER Annual volume of new hires has doubled, yet resources to deliver orientation are in shorter supply The businesses have deployed new talent models, while national focus is limited to the historical few We have an opportunity to further leverage technological advances around social, mobile, and analytics Deloitte University opened its doors, setting a new standard for exceptional customer experiences High annual travel costs Fewer new hires feeling job ready Frequent last-minute requests for facilitators and leaders Designed for campus hires when over 50% of hires join with experience Technology and resource delays for 20% of experienced hires Greater than 50% of orientation time spent on administrative tasks Problem framing Research Synthesis Reframing Ideate Refine Prototype Test Present

5 Guidelines and lessons learned
Invite the Learner to the party Set aside obstacles and ask “How might we?” Curate stories and empathize Adopt a bias for action ─ Fail fast Explore new twists on existing ideas Focus on the experience and broaden the scope Exaggerate your goals and celebrate success

6 Your turn! How might you get started?
Identify a challenging problem that exists in your world Frame design challenges as questions Engage with learners to empathize and reframe
